Ishaq Dar Calls for In-Camera Briefing on Terrorism from Caretaker Government

ISLAMABAD: PML-N central leader Senator Ishaq Dar has demanded that the caretaker government provide an in-camera briefing on the issue of terrorism.

Speaking at the Senate meeting, Ishaq Dar stated that meaningful action against terrorists had not been taken in the past. The decision of Zarb Azab was made during the Nawaz Sharif government. After 2013, there was a decrease in terrorist activities, but a change in policy occurred after 2018.

Ishaq Dar mentioned that when the Taliban government took control of Afghanistan, our officials went there. Under the understanding in Kabul, hundreds of hard-line terrorists were released from Pakistani jails.

He further expressed that a U-turn was taken on the policy, and after the release of hardened terrorists, terrorism increased in the country.

Senator Ishaq Dar emphasized that the caretaker government should provide an in-camera briefing on terrorism. If someone suggests waiting for action against terrorists, he said, “Wait for February 8; there is no waiting for such things.”
